    Dollar Store Farmhouse Fall Door Hanger

    Give your home a touch of farmhouse styled charm with this DIY dollar store farmhouse fall door hanger. It’s an easy project that only takes 30 minutes and costs under $10 in supplies.

    Supplies for Farmhouse Fall Door Hanger:

    • 4 dollar store leaf trays
    • white spray paint
    • black vinyl stickers (3 or 4 inch letters)
      OR stencils, foam brush and black paint
      OR Cricut Explorer Air 2 & black vinyl (This is the method I used with some scrap vinyl)
      OR painted chipboard letters
    • roll of wired burlap ribbon
    • floral wire
    • tape measure or ruler
    • hot glue gun & 2 glue sticks
    • scissors

    Total Cost: $10
    Difficulty Level: Easy
    Time: 30-40 minutes (not counting the time it takes for the spray paint to dry)

    You can get the leaf trays, burlap ribbon, floral wire, vinyl letters & glue sticks at Dollar Tree and get the spray paint for a couple of dollars at Walmart.

    Dollar Store Farmhouse Fall Door Hanger

    Instructions for Farmhouse Fall Door Hanger:

    1. Spray paint the $1 leaf trays white. Let it dry overnight. It’s best if you spray paint the night before you plan to do the craft.
    2. Adhere or paint your letters onto the middle of each leaf tray. I used a Cricut Explorer Air 2 to make my letters.
    3. Make your burlap bow.
      You will need: 1 6″ ribbon, 1 12″ ribbon, 2 16″ ribbons, floral wire and a glue gun to make the ribbon.
      Here is a quick 1 minute video for how to make the burlap ribbon.
    4. Generously glue the leaf trays onto the burlap ribbon. Make sure that the trays are centered and equal distance from each other. You could use a tape measure to do this. Also, you may want to put a newspaper underneath where you are gluing because the glue will seep through the burlap ribbon.
    5. Make a V cut on the end of the ribbon
    6. Hang the door hanger with a command hook by puncturing the top of the ribbon with a small hole using a craft knife
